Strom Jane Strom "And whosoever liveth and believeth in me shall never die." John 11:26 Jane Strom, born September 11, 1920 to Lloyd Pilgrim and Olga Schmidt in St. Croix Falls, WI and passed away on July 3, 2005. She was one of eight children; brothers, James, Floyd, Marvin and Charles; sisters, Alice, Viola and Florence. Jane was married to Earl W. Strom on March 4, 1944 for 55 years. Preceded in death by parents; husband, Earl; and loving and devoted son, William Earl Strom. She is survived by loving son, Peter James Strom of Maplewood, MN; caring daughter-in-law, Ramona D. Strom (West) of Columbia Heights, MN; and special nieces and nephews. Jane was a devoted mother who devoted much of her time caring for her sons. Life gave her many challenges but she always had a smile on her face and at the end a song in her heart. The family would like to thank all the people who cared for Jane the last couple of years and to let them know that she truly appreciated your love and attention. A graveside service will be held at 10:30 AM SHARP on July 7, 2005 at Fort Snelling National Cemetery, Assembly Area #6. Any memorials can be sent In Memory of Jane to a charity of your choice or to the Roseville Good Samaritan Center, Alzheimer's Unit, 1415 West County Road B, Roseville, MN 55113.
